Neet is the sole entrance test for admission to MBBS  and other medical and paramedical courses in India. The exam is organised by the National Testing Agency.

Admissions through NEET are basically categorised in two types of quota i.e., All India Quota (AIQ) and State Level Quota. All India Quota comprises 15 per cent of the overall seats and the rest of the 85 per cent are filled under state-level quota.

With 498 marks, getting mbbs seat is impossible!! But can get bds. Here is a list of all government medical colleges in Bihar and their respective cut offs for admission under the 85% State quota for in 2018
Considering your rank you don't seem to have any chance for admission in any government medical colleges in Bihar
  • Jawaharlal Nehru Medical College, Bhagalpur -450
  • Nalanda Medical College, Patna- 454
  • Government Medical College, Bettiah- 451
  • Vardhman Institute of Medical Sciences, Pawapuri, Nalanda -452
  • Indira Gandhi Institute of Medical Sciences, Sheikhpura, Patna - 465
  • Anugrah Narayan Magadh Medical College, Gaya -454
  • Sri Krishna Medical College, Muzaffarpur- 448
  • Patna Medical College, Patna- 461
  • Darbhanga Medical College, Lehriasarai- 454
